02038969255 Summary (Read all comments)
Phone number ☎️ 02038969255 👆 is reported as a scam involving calls from someone pretending to be HSBC about suspicious transactions in Aberdeen. Many users say the caller claims unauthorised spending or login attempts on their bank accounts, often mentioning Screwfix purchases. Several people don’t even have HSBC accounts but still got called. The calls use automated voices and try to trick you into sharing info or recording your voice. It’s a well known scam targeting bank customers with urgent warnings and fake alerts. Users urge reporting these calls through official channels and warn against engaging with the scammers at all. Overall, a persistent fraud attempt trying to harvest personal and banking details under the guise of HSBC security alerts.

About 02 Numbers
These digits are linked with specific locations in the UK and are frequently used by residential and commercial properties. Sometimes referred to as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the costs for these geographic numbers are dependent on the time of day. A good number of service providers offer call packages that allow free calls during particular times. Call costs from mobile phones are based on the chosen calling plan, with various plans providing these numbers in their free call packages.
